Output 51f431a864a960c20515534fd6d0ceecb85b7cbe89b157ce0512a0ffee6e6c2a:0
- value
- 625896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5b157cfdb74a6da5ff4ce880e78cc4f4eaf111c OP_EQUAL
- address
- MUqfRNJV9drUNQwzSwYUhDos1gwwKM7GY6
- transaction
- 51f431a864a960c20515534fd6d0ceecb85b7cbe89b157ce0512a0ffee6e6c2a
- spent
- true